How We’ve Prepared
HFG’s policy is to respond to a significant business disruption by safeguarding employees and clients, making an operational assessment, implementing a work-remotely initiative including well-tested tools, technology, capacity and security measures to support a remote workforce, quickly recovering and resuming critical business operations, and protecting all of our books and records.
In the event that HFG staff members are unable to work from our office location due to a pandemic event, we have developed and tested a multi-tiered action plan based on guidelines from the World Health Organization. Please know that based on our plan, at no point in time will you be unable to communicate with our firm. You will always be able to reach staff members via phone or email and we will do our best to continue business operations as normal with as little disruption as possible.
Below are a few highlights from our Business Continuity Plan.
- Designated alternative physical location of employees
- Continued access to all necessary programs and technology
- Continued access to HFG computer systems through a secure virtual private network
- Continued access to the HFG phone system
- Continued access to the HFG email system
- Secure and accessible back-up of all vital business records
In addition, as a branch office of LPL Financial, we have the large-scale, back-office support of LPL. LPL has a dedicated Emergency Response Team that manages all risks to business continuity, including public health issues. Their team is meeting daily on the Coronavirus and is in continuous contact with members of the Centers for Disease Control (CDC). LPL also has a very strong Business Continuity Plan which outlines the steps LPL will take before, during and after any type of emergency event.
